Common Roofing Issues
When it concerns keeping the stability of your home, resolving typical roof problems is critical. House owners commonly run into a selection of roof issues that can compromise the architectural safety and security and aesthetic charm of their home. One of the most prevalent issue is roof covering leakages, which can develop from damaged tiles, incorrect blinking, or blocked rain gutters. These leakages can cause water damages, mold development, and raised energy prices if not immediately resolved.
An additional usual trouble is the presence of missing out on or damaged tiles. Extreme climate conditions, age, and inadequate setup can add to roof shingles wear and tear. In addition, indicators of sagging or uneven roofing lines may suggest underlying architectural problems that call for prompt focus.
The buildup of debris, such as leaves and branches, can catch moisture and promote the development of moss or algae, both of which can damage roofing materials over time. Ultimately, inadequate ventilation can cause warm buildup in the attic, leading to early wear of roofing elements (Roof Repair). By recognizing these typical concerns, house owners can take aggressive steps to assure their roofs continue to be in excellent problem and protect their financial investment

Fixing Leakages and Cracks

Searching for and fixing leakages and cracks in your roof is important to keeping its honesty and protecting against more damages. To begin the fixing process, perform a comprehensive evaluation of the roof covering, particularly after severe weather. Search for visible indicators such as water stains on ceilings, drooping areas, or harmed blinking.
Once you recognize the resource of the leakage, tidy the area around the fracture or leak to assure proper attachment of repair work materials. For tiny fractures, a premium roof covering sealant can be used. Utilize a caulking weapon to dispense the sealant, guaranteeing it fills the crack totally and prolongs past its sides. Smooth the sealant with a putty blade for a smooth coating.
For larger leaks or openings, consider making use of a patching method. Cut a piece of roof covering material that prolongs a minimum of 2 inches past the damaged area. Apply roof covering concrete to the underside of the patch and press it firmly onto the leakage. Seal the sides with extra cement, ensuring a leak-proof bond.
After fixings, keep an eye on the area throughout rainstorms to validate the efficiency of your work. Timely focus to leaks and cracks will certainly lengthen your roof covering's life-span and keep your home's safety and security.

Installation Process Explained
With the needed tools gathered, the setup procedure for replacing missing roof shingles can start. Confirm security by using appropriate protective equipment, consisting of handwear covers and a difficult hat. Beginning by meticulously getting rid of any kind of damaged or loose shingles bordering the location where the substitute is required. Make use of a pry bar to lift the existing shingles gently, making sure not to damage those still undamaged.
Next, prepare the area for the new shingle installation. Clean the subjected surface of any type of particles or old adhesive. If the underlayment is damaged, replace it to avoid leaks. Select a brand-new shingle that matches the existing roofing in color and style. Placement the new shingle in accordance with the roofing's pattern, verifying it overlaps correctly with surrounding roof shingles.
Secure the brand-new shingle utilizing roofing nails, positioning them in the assigned nail strip to avoid water seepage. Apply roofing sticky under the shingle's edges for added protection against wind and water. Evaluate the completed installation for correct alignment and safe and secure attachment. Dispose of any kind of debris sensibly and carry out a final check of the roofing to confirm all tiles are intact and properly secured.

What Are the Indicators of a Roof That Has Continual Tornado Damage?
Identifying storm damages on a roof covering is essential for maintaining its integrity. Key indications include missing or harmed shingles, noticeable leaks inside the home, granules collecting in rain gutters, and misaligned or curved flashing. Furthermore, check for cracks or holes in the roof structure and evaluate for any sagging locations. If these indications exist, it is recommended to seek advice from a specialist for a detailed analysis and proper remediation actions.

Can I Install New Roofing Shingles Over Old Ones?
Mounting brand-new shingles over old ones is possible, yet it is normally not suggested. This strategy may save time and labor costs; nevertheless, it can cause irregular surfaces, raised weight on the roof structure, and potential wetness retention problems. It is a good idea to eliminate the old roof shingles to ensure proper setup, improve the roof covering's long life, and keep service warranty insurance coverage. Consulting a roof covering specialist for customized advice is also recommended.
